Locals in St. John's for CFUW

Three delegates from the South Delta University Women's Club attended the Canadian Federation of University Women's annual general meeting in St. John's, Newfoundland, earlier this month.

Past-president Paula McLaughlin, Nadereh Houchmand and Beryl Matthewson took part in the meeting that addressed many resolutions.

Canadian Federation of University Women members are active in public affairs to improve education, environment, peace, justice and human rights.

There are close to 10,000 members in Canada, about 2,000 of them in 23 clubs across B.C.

Interested women are invited to a prospective members reception, which will be held on Tuesday, Sept. 13, from 7 to 9 p.m., at the Royal Oaks clubhouse on 56th Street.

The club welcomes graduates from any postsecondary program, and raises scholarship funds for local students.
